HP 3325A¶
HP 3325A¶
| Status | abandoned |
| Frequency (sine) | 20MHz |
| Frequency (square) | 10MHz |
| Frequency (other) | 10KHz (triangle, sawtooth) |
| Waveforms | sine, square, triangle, sawtooth |
| Modulation | AM, FM |
| Connectivity | GPIB |
| Website | keysight.com |
The Hewlett-Packard 3325A is a 20MHz function generator with GPIB connectivity.

Status¶
mrnuke had a 3325A, but he had to get rid of it before he could implement sigrok support. As such, the project is currently abandoned. The page is left as a quick reference on how to configure the GPIB controller, in case anyone wants to pick this up.
